蜘蛛池IP是一种高效的网络爬虫与IP池利用方式,通过整合多个IP资源,实现快速抓取和高效访问。它支持秒收录,能够迅速响应网络请求,提高爬虫效率和准确性。蜘蛛池IP还具备高稳定性和安全性,能够保障数据安全和隐私。这种利用方式适用于各种网络爬虫场景,如电商、新闻、金融等领域,能够大幅提升数据获取速度和准确性。
在数字化时代,网络爬虫(Web Crawler)作为一种重要的数据收集工具,被广泛应用于搜索引擎优化、市场研究、数据分析等多个领域,随着网络环境的日益复杂,IP封禁和访问限制成为网络爬虫面临的主要挑战之一,蜘蛛池IP作为一种解决方案,通过集中管理和分配IP资源,有效提高了网络爬虫的效率和稳定性,本文将深入探讨蜘蛛池IP的概念、工作原理、优势以及在实际应用中的具体策略。
一、蜘蛛池IP的基本概念
1.1 定义
蜘蛛池IP,顾名思义,是指为网络爬虫提供稳定、多样化的IP资源池,这些IP资源通常来自不同的运营商、地理位置和自治系统(AS),以模拟真实用户的访问行为,避免被目标网站识别为爬虫而遭到封禁。
1.2 工作原理
蜘蛛池IP通过代理服务器或VPN等技术,将爬虫的请求转发至不同的IP地址,每个请求都像是来自一个独立的用户,从而增加了爬虫的隐蔽性和灵活性,智能调度系统能够根据爬虫的需求和IP的可用性,动态分配最优的IP资源,确保爬虫的高效运行。
二、蜘蛛池IP的优势
2.1 提高爬取效率
由于蜘蛛池IP能够模拟多用户并发访问,大大提升了爬虫的抓取速度和覆盖范围,特别是对于大型网站或高并发场景,蜘蛛池IP能够显著缩短爬取时间,提高数据收集的效率。
2.2 降低被封禁的风险
通过分散IP来源和使用策略,蜘蛛池IP有效降低了单个IP因频繁请求而被目标网站封禁的风险,即使某个IP被封禁,其他备用IP也能立即接管,确保爬虫的持续运行。
2.3 节省成本
相比于购买大量独立IP或使用昂贵的VPN服务,蜘蛛池IP提供了更为经济高效的解决方案,用户只需按需付费,即可获得稳定的IP资源支持。
2.4 灵活性高
蜘蛛池IP支持多种协议和自定义配置,能够满足不同爬虫的需求,无论是HTTP、HTTPS还是SOCKS代理,用户都可以根据具体场景选择合适的代理类型。
三、蜘蛛池IP的应用策略
3.1 合理分配IP资源
根据爬虫的目标网站、抓取频率和预期流量,合理规划和分配IP资源,避免过度集中使用同一批IP,以减少被封禁的风险,根据目标网站的地理位置分布,选择相应的地域性IP资源,以提高爬虫的访问速度。
3.2 设定合理的请求间隔
为了避免触发目标网站的防爬虫机制,需要设定合理的请求间隔,通常建议根据目标网站的响应速度和服务条款,设置适当的延迟时间,对于允许高频访问的网站,可以缩短请求间隔;而对于限制访问频率的网站,则需要延长请求间隔。
3.3 监控与调整
定期对爬虫的运行状态进行监控和评估,包括爬取速度、成功率、异常报警等关键指标,根据监控结果及时调整策略,如增加备用IP数量、优化请求参数等,以确保爬虫的高效稳定运行。
3.4 遵守法律法规和道德规范
在使用蜘蛛池IP进行网络爬虫时,必须严格遵守相关法律法规和道德规范,不得进行恶意攻击、窃取敏感信息或侵犯他人隐私等行为,尊重目标网站的服务条款和隐私政策,合理合法地获取和使用数据。
四、案例分析:蜘蛛池IP在电商数据分析中的应用
4.1 背景介绍
某电商平台希望对其竞争对手的产品价格、销量等数据进行监控和分析,直接访问竞争对手的网站可能会触发反爬虫机制导致访问受限,该电商平台决定采用蜘蛛池IP进行网络爬虫以获取所需数据。
4.2 实施步骤
1、选择蜘蛛池服务:根据需求选择合适的蜘蛛池服务提供商,并获取相应的API接口和配置文档。
2、配置爬虫程序:根据API接口编写爬虫程序,实现数据抓取功能,同时设置合理的请求间隔和重试机制以提高爬取成功率。
3、数据清洗与存储:对抓取到的数据进行清洗和整理,去除重复、无效信息后存储到数据库或数据仓库中供后续分析使用。
4、监控与优化:定期监控爬虫的运行状态和数据质量,根据反馈结果调整策略以优化爬取效果。
5、合规性检查:确保整个过程中遵守相关法律法规和道德规范,避免侵犯他人权益或造成不良影响。
4.3 成果展示
经过一段时间的爬取和数据分析后,该电商平台成功获取了竞争对手的产品价格、销量等关键数据,通过对这些数据的深入分析,该电商平台能够及时调整自身策略以应对市场竞争压力并提升市场份额,由于采用了蜘蛛池IP进行网络爬虫操作并未触发任何反爬虫机制或法律纠纷问题发生,因此该案例证明了蜘蛛池IP在网络爬虫中的有效性和可行性。
五、总结与展望
随着网络环境的不断发展和变化以及网络爬虫技术的日益成熟和完善,“蜘蛛池”作为一种高效且稳定的网络爬虫解决方案将逐渐受到更多企业和个人的青睐和关注。“蜘蛛池”不仅能够帮助用户突破访问限制提高数据收集效率;同时也能够降低被封禁的风险并节省成本开支;更重要的是它还能够为用户提供更加灵活多样的选择以满足不同场景下的需求。“未来随着技术的不断进步和创新,“蜘蛛池”将会拥有更加广阔的应用前景和无限的发展潜力。”